WebSep 29, 2024 · Real gross domestic product (GDP) decreased at an annual rate of 0.6 percent in the second quarter of 2024 (table 1), according to the "third" estimate released by the Bureau of Economic Analysis.In the first quarter, real GDP decreased 1.6 percent (same as previously published). The “third” estimate of GDP released today is based on more …

WebJul 28, 2024 · Real gross domestic product (GDP) decreased at an annual rate of 0.9 percent in the second quarter of 2024 (table 1), according to the "advance" estimate released by the Bureau of Economic Analysis. In the first quarter, real GDP decreased 1.6 percent. WebDec 11, 2024 · Green Gross Domestic Product (GGDP) GGDP essentially penalizes a country for employing manufacturing practices that harm the environment. Such practices are seen as unsustainable, and, thus, many believe that they should be counted against a country’s GDP.
